Mediterranean Style Prawns With Garlic And Feta Cheese
- 12 large prawns, deveined and butterflied
- 1 lemon, juice of
- 1/2 cup butter
- 5 -6 cloves fresh minced garlic (more if desired)
- 1/4 cup white wine
- 1/2 cup chopped fresh parsley, to taste
- 1 large tomatoes, diced
- 1/2 cup black olives, pitted
- 3 green onions, chopped
- 3/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led
- pepper
- In a large skillet, melt the butter on medium-low heat.
- Add in the garlic and prawns, constantly stirring, and turning the prawns, using a large wooden spoon.
- After turning the prawns once, add in the white wine, juice of one lemon, and the pepper; continue to stir the sauce, and turn prawns until they turn light pink, and are lightly firm.
- Add in the green onions, parsley, tomato, stirring all the ingredients continuosly.
- When the prawns are pink and firm, remove from the pan.
- Lightly stir in the feta cheese, and serve immediately.
